When it comes to insulating your home, one of the most effective methods is through the use of insulation cavity walls. This form of insulation involves the placement of insulation material in the gap or cavity between the inner and outer walls of a building. One of the main advantages of insulation cavity walls is their ability to reduce thermal bridging. Thermal bridging occurs when there is a break in the insulation layer, allowing heat to escape or enter the home through the walls. Cavity wall insulation helps to create a continuous layer of insulation, significantly reducing thermal bridging and improving the overall energy efficiency of the building.
Another advantage of insulation cavity walls is their ability to reduce condensation within the walls. Condensation occurs when warm, moist air comes into contact with a cold surface, such as an uninsulated wall. This can lead to mold growth, rotting of the wood structure, and other issues that can compromise the integrity of your home. By insulating the cavity walls, you can create a barrier that prevents warm air from coming into contact with the cold surface, reducing the risk of condensation and its associated problems.

There are several insulation materials that can be used in cavity walls, including fiberglass, mineral wool, foam boards, and cellulose. Each material has its own advantages and considerations, so it is important to consult with a professional insulation contractor to determine the best option for your specific needs.
It is worth noting that the installation of insulation cavity walls should be carried out by trained and experienced professionals. Improper installation can lead to gaps, voids, or compression of the insulation material, reducing its effectiveness and potentially causing other issues.
